“Apon Aloy: Tribute to Bangladeshi Lyricist Jangi”

-

A special event called “Apon Aloy Shahid Mahmud Jangi: Gane Gane Sattor” is scheduled for 12 December to honor the 70-year life and artistic journey of the esteemed Bangladeshi lyricist Shahid Mahmud Jangi. Jangi, a key figure in shaping the music scene of Bangladesh during the 1980s and 1990s, is celebrated for his classic compositions like “Hridoy kadamatir kono murti noy,” “Aaj je shishu prithibir aloy eshechhe,” “Ami bhule jai tumi amar now,” “Jotiner sirer klase,” “Tritiyo Bishwo,” and “Shomoy jeno kate na.” He is renowned for his work with iconic bands such as Souls, Renaissance, and LRB, along with various solo artists.

The event, organized by Ajob Karkhana, will be held at Russian House in Dhanmondi, commencing at 5 pm. It will kick off with introductory speeches and reminiscences from special guests, followed by the unveiling of a commemorative book titled “Apon Aloy Shahid Mahmud Jangi: Gane Gane Sattor,” edited by Joy Shahriar. The book features personal anecdotes and praises from prominent musicians including Nakib Khan, Samina Chowdhury, Faisal Siddiqui Bagi, Fuad Nasser Babu, Kumar Bishwajit, Pilu Khan, Nasim Ali Khan, Partha Barua, Liton Adhikari Rintu, Golam Morshed, and Bappi Khan.

The event will also include live renditions of Jangi’s timeless melodies starting from 6:30 pm. Performers such as Rafiqul Alam, Nasim Ali Khan, Bappa Mazumder, Pantho Kanai, Suman Kalyan, Joy Shahriar, Kishore Dash, and bands like Souls and Renaissance are set to showcase his iconic songs. The organizing team comprises Nakib Khan, Partha Barua, Pilu Khan, Joy Shahriar, Shamim Ahmed, Enam Elahi Tonti, Suman Kalyan, Shakil Khan, and Hasan Asad.
